To start with, jasmine tea is usually made using green tea as its base, though black and white teas are also utilized. The most popular kind of jasmine tea is Chinese jasmine tea, which is created largely in the Fujian district and is recognized for its intricate scenting process.
Among the standout features of jasmine tea is its unique shape. Jasmine tea can be found in numerous forms, consisting of pearls, loose leaf, and sachets. Jasmine tea pearls, especially, are developed by hand-rolling the leaves into small, tight packages, which not just maintain their scent during storage but also spread out perfectly when made. In comparison, loose leaf jasmine tea permits a more direct brewing experience, letting the tea significances blend effortlessly with the water. Understanding these different shapes can help in choosing the type of jasmine tea that best suits specific choices and brewing techniques.
Brewing jasmine tea correctly is important for removing its complete flavor account. To produce a perfect mug, it is suggested to use fresh, filtered water at a temperature level of around 175 ° F( 80 ° C)for green jasmine tea. The steeping time is usually around 2 to 3 mins, although you might need to change this depending upon the particular brand name or sort of tea being used. For jasmine pearls, utilizing a teapot with a strainer can boost the yield of taste as the pearls roll freely and launch their essence right into the water. The resulting tea ought to be light gold to pale green in shade, and the aroma will certainly envelop you with pleasing floral notes, developing a sensory experience that complements the preference.

The best way to brew jasmine tea includes making use of water that is around 175 ° F to 185 ° F (80 ° C to 85 ° C) for green jasmine tea and boiling water for black jasmine tea. The steeping time will differ; usually, green jasmine tea ought to be soaked for about 2 to 3 mins, while black jasmine tea may need 3 to 5 mins.

Amongst the lots of selections of jasmine tea, Guangxi Hengxian jasmine tea attracts attention. Sourced from the Hengxian region, this tea is renowned for its elegant fragrance and excellent quality. The manufacturing process includes traditional methods of scenting, ensuring that each set catches the essence of the jasmine blossoms. Hengxian jasmine tea is commonly defined by its smooth taste and flower scent, making it a favorite amongst those seeking a premium jasmine experience.
